It was actually 3 times in Common Interest. So I believe the 4 other occurences you're referring to would be Just in Time, False Start, and 2 time in The Key. Though, with the exception of Just in Time, none of them are actually true deaths. More like cardiac arrest or some sort of heart failure, in which her heart stops beating properly meaning a loss of blood flow (though I can't say much for the final "death" in The Key).

Though she would be clinically dead, it wasn't really actual death. Actually, in certain European countries, stopping a heart from beating and stopping blow flow is part of heart surgery. Instead of certain countries where they use an artificial pump to keep blood flowing, they cover you in ice until your body reaches hypothermia. So for 1-2 hrs, you are, by clinical definition, dead.
